InfoQ Homepage Agile Content on InfoQ
-
Forty Years of Teams
Tim Lister describes his work as a colleague, as an apprentice, as a mentor, and as a mediator noting how team dynamics have changed over the years, and how they bring new challenges to collaboration.
-
Building SOLID Foundations
Nat Pryce, Steve Freeman advise on design principles useful to create code structures with objects that fit together and communicate, and where the capabilities and the information flow are explicit.
-
Case Study: It's Not Your Fault - Why Targets Don't Work
Francis Fish discusses applying systems thinking and the ideas of W Edwards Deming to organizations, and why targets don't work.
-
Stop That! Questioning Dogmatic Programming
Doug Hiebert questions conventional wisdom that is taken for granted when writing code, and presents alternatives by way of before-and-after examples.
-
« We Do Agile ». Why Is It Difficult for Solution Centers to Be Agile?
Ernst Perpignand presents some real world solution center initiatives along with their shortcomings, exposing the underlying patterns and some ideas on how to avoid the pitfalls.
-
Continuous Deployment the Octopus Way
Jimmy Bogard introduces Octopus Deploy, a deployment system for continuous delivery.
-
Think With Your Hands! Using 3D Model Building to Build Up Your Team
Ellen Grove teaches improving personal development using the Lego Serious Play thinking, communicating and problem solving technique.
-
Accelerating Agile: Hyper-performing without the Hype
Dan North shares insight on how high-performing teams work, the patterns and ideas being genuine experiences from practitioners. This is Agile in actuality. Agile is an attitude, not a rule book.
-
Shut Up and Play Yer Guitar, Again
David Hussman combats the addiction to a specific process, discussing various topics such as product thinking, regression deficit, building teams and connecting programs to portfolios.
-
Experience Report: Growing eXtreme Programming Teams
Rachel Davies reports on how Unruly Media is using XP and how they have adapted to increasing scalability needs.
-
DevOps at a Small International Bank - Contiguous Improvement over Continuous Delivery
Ola Ellnestam shares lessons learned and DevOps practices along with the underlying values and principles used to implement continuous improvement and delivery at a large bank.
-
Methodology Patterns: a Different Approach to Create a Methodology for Your Project
Giovanni Asproni suggests that teams should not blindly embrace a methodology but rather create their own suiting their specific needs by using an approach based on patterns and pattern languages.